    The Influence of Job Training, Career Development and Compensation on Employee Performance at BPJS Ketenagakerjaan Medan Kota Branch

    In the era of increasingly competitive job competition, job training, career development, and compensation are important factors in improving employee performance. Proper job training can improve employee skills and confidence in completing tasks. Clear career development encourages employee motivation and loyalty to the company. Meanwhile, fair compensation that is in accordance with employee contributions can increase work satisfaction and productivity. The combination of these three factors is needed to form superior human resources and support the achievement of organizational goals. This research aims to determine and analyze the influence of job training, career development, and compensation on employee performance at BPJS Ketenagakerjaan Medan Kota Branch. This is a quantitative research using both primary and secondary data. The data analysis method employed is descriptive quantitative with multiple linear regression analysis, assisted by SPSS software. The population in this study includes all permanent employees of BPJS Ketenagakerjaan Medan Kota Branch, totaling 38 individuals, all of whom were taken as the sample using a saturated sampling technique. The results of the study show that the job training variable partially has a positive and significant effect on employee performance at BPJS Ketenagakerjaan Medan Kota Branch. Career development also has a positive and significant partial effect on employee performance at the same institution. Similarly, compensation partially has a positive and significant effect on employee performance. The simultaneous significance test shows that job training, career development, and compensation together have a positive and significant influence on employee performance at BPJS Ketenagakerjaan Medan Kota Branch.
